Prepare the Yogurt Mixture: In a large mixing bowl, combine 2 cups of Greek yogurt, 2 tablespoons of honey (or maple syrup), and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ract. Stir until smooth and well-blended.
Add Toppings and Mix: Add 1/2 cup of granola or oats, 1/4 cup of dried fruits (raisins, cranberries, etc.), and 1/4 cup of nuts or seeds (almonds, chia seeds, etc.) to the yogurt mixture. Mix gently until everything is evenly distributed.
Set in a Pan: Line a baking dish or pan with parchment paper for easy removal. Pour the yogurt mixture into the pan and spread it out evenly, ensuring it reaches all corners.
Freeze and Slice: Cover the pan with plastic wrap and freeze for at least 3 hours or until firm. Once frozen, remove from the pan, cut into bars, and store in an airtight container in the freezer or refrigerator.
